Thursday on the News Hour, the U.S. war with Iran widens, threatening energy infrastructure and risking more countries being pulled into the conflict. We speak with Iranian Americans who express hope and fear about what comes next for their country. Plus, President Trump replaced Homeland Security Secretary Kristi Noem after months of controversy over the immigration crackdown.
